1956 – 2004

LEWISTON – Jeffrey A. Pickens, 47, a resident of Warren Road, Monmouth, died suddenly Friday, Jan. 2 at Central Maine Medical Center.

He was born in Port Hueneme, Calif. on Sept. 3, 1956, the son of Luman C. and Dorothy M. Trial Pickens. He attended the schools of Winthrop and was a 1975 graduate of Kents Hill. He served in the United States Marine Corps from 1975 to 1977.

On March 7, 1993, he married Emily Fitzpatrick in Lewiston. He worked as a construction laborer and was also a talented guitarist. He was a member of the Guilford Mason Lodge and the Kora Shriners of Lewiston.

He is survived by his mother of Winthrop; his wife of Monmouth; two daughters, Jessica Pickens of Puerto Rico, and Dorothy Pickens of Guilford; a son, Aric Pickens of Rockland; three step-sons, Joseph Fitzpatrick of Boston, Michael Fitzpatrick of Portland, and Eric Fizpatrick of Monmouth; a sister, Denaige Blaisdell and her husband Richard of Leeds; and a niece, Amy Blaisdell.
